Annual costs are shown for the selected household. The difference column shows how much more or less the category costs in Baltimore city, MD compared with Nassau County, NY.
| Category | Nassau County, NY | Baltimore city, MD | Annual difference | Monthly impact | Direction |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Taxes | $18,672 | $9,460 | -$9,212(-49.34%) | -$768 | Lower in Baltimore city, MD |
| Housing | $22,202 | $13,748 | -$8,454(-38.08%) | -$705 | Lower in Baltimore city, MD |
| Transport | $13,523 | $9,623 | -$3,900(-28.84%) | -$325 | Lower in Baltimore city, MD |
| Healthcare | $8,055 | $4,290 | -$3,765(-46.74%) | -$314 | Lower in Baltimore city, MD |
| Other Costs | $8,373 | $5,802 | -$2,571(-30.71%) | -$214 | Lower in Baltimore city, MD |
| Food | $4,766 | $4,939 | +$173(3.63%) | +$14 | Higher in Baltimore city, MD |
| Childcare | $0 | $0 | $0(0%) | $0 | About even |

WatchPennies uses county-level 2026 cost estimates from a 2025-2026 cost-data snapshot. The comparison includes housing, food, transportation, healthcare, childcare, other necessities, taxes, total cost, and median family income context when available.
